Amanda Seyfried has just now dished that even after more than two decades of Mean Girls’, the production still owes her some money.
The 39-year-old actress starred in the movie alongside Rachel McAdams, Lindsay Lohan, Lacey Chabert and Tina Fey.
During an interview with Adam Brody on Variety’s Actors on Actors, she was asked if she’s re-watched the 2004 teen comedy movie.
“No. It’s on often enough though,” the Mamma Mia! actress began by responding.
Seyfried continued, “I love it. I really love seeing my face on people’s T-shirts. I’m a little resentful because Paramount still owes me some money for the likeness.”
